2025 Compare Cities Overview:
Rhinebeck, NY vs Manchester, VT
Change Cities
Highlights
Are people in Manchester older or younger than people in Rhinebeck?
- The Median Age in Manchester is 1.5 years younger than in Rhinebeck.
Are housing costs cheaper in Manchester or Rhinebeck?
- Manchester
housing
costs are 3.4% less expensive than Rhinebeck hous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Manchester or Rhinebeck?
- The average commute for residents of Manchester is 9.1 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Rhinebeck.
Things to do in Rhinebeck?
Living in Rhinebeck, NY is truly a unique experience. Nestled in the Hudson Valley, it boasts stunning views of the Catskill Mountains and beautiful rolling hills. The area offers plenty of outdoor activities like hiking, biking, canoeing and fishing to keep you entertained all year round. The village itself also provides plenty of entertainment and shopping options ranging from small antique stores to more modern eateries. Rhinebeck is filled with culture and is known for its quaint charm while still having access to larger cities nearby if needed. The locals are friendly and welcoming, making it easy to feel right at home here in this idyllic little town!
Things to do in Manchester?
Manchester, VT is a small town located in the Green Mountains of Vermont. It has an idyllic atmosphere with charming streets lined with brick-front buildings and plenty of outdoor activities to keep you busy throughout the year. In summer, you can go fishing or swimming in the many rivers and streams in the area, while winter brings a variety of skiing and snowshoeing opportunities. Along with its beautiful landscape, Manchester offers plenty of shopping and dining options, as well as art galleries and museums. The people are friendly and welcoming, making it a great place to live for those who want to experience a small-town feel while living close to larger cities like Burlington and Rutland.
